Now in its Second Edition, Principles of Management by Tony Morden is a proven textbook that offers a comprehensive introduction to the theory and practice of management. In addition to explaining the fundamentals, this book now takes the reader to the leading edge of the discipline. The Second Edition contains new material on leadership, trust, stress management, teamwork, the public sector, and knowledge management. It is assumed that in business an international context is now the norm, and Part Five examines global styles of management. Arranged in sharply focused parts and chapters, the text is further broken down into accessible sections. The exposition is clear and reader-friendly. Principles of Management is ideal for use on undergraduate, conversion masters, and MBA courses in business and management. Its accessible structure and style make it highly suitable for modular courses and distance learning programmes, or for self-directed study and continuing personal professional development.
